Krabi
Limestone pinnacles, rocky coves and deserted beaches fringed by a vista of tiny islands - Krabi's coastline is undeniably beautiful. Venture inland and an equally fascinating interior filled with tropical forest, rice fields and plantations emerges to make this lovely province one of Thailand's rare gems. Relatively new to tourism, many of Krabi's stylish modern hotels have excellent facilities, gardens and views over the sea or surrounding mountains. Almost all resorts are low rise - complying with local rules not to exceed the height of a coconut tree! There's a good range of Hotels in Ao Nang with luxury high-end Hotels in Klong Muang, Basic bungalows and a boutique resort can be found in Railey Beach - popular during the high season, with a few hotels in Krabi Town. Krabi's lovely coastline is fringed with lots of tiny coves, towering headlands, hidden beaches and offshore islands. The most developed beach is at Ao Nang followed by Railey Beach (accessible only by boat) and Klong Muang Beach. Part of the Hat Noppharat - Phi Phi Islands National Park, there are literally hundreds of islands - mostly uninhabited - just off the coast. The larger islands like Koh Lanta and the fabled Phi Phi Islands offer tranquility and unsurpassed beauty. (More)

Still relatively un-commercialised Krabi nevertheless gets quite busy during the peak season (Dec-Jan) so it's best to book accommodation in advance.
Located on the Andaman seaboard, Krabi province is just a three hour drive from Phuket (176 km) on the Andaman coast and a 3 hour drive from Koh Samui (via mainland Surathani (211 km from Krabi) on the opposite Gulf of Siam coast.
No direct flights operate to date between Koh Samui and Krabi, but may do so in the future.
From Bangkok - Thai Airways, Bangkok Airways, Andaman Air, Phuket Airlines or PB Air and Silk Air fly to the new Krabi Airport. Schedules vary with the season..(More)
